Book excerpt: Tourism development is not merely about boosting tourist figures and bringing in more tourist dollars. Undoubtedly, it has to do with developing tourism resources, infrastructure, products, and attractions, but it is also about a society, polity, and economy meeting the challenges of globalization, the new millennium, and nation-building. This book deals with those issues from different perspectives and through the case of Singapore, a city-state highly integrated into the global economy. It addresses specific areas like tourism manpower, theme parks, and beaches, as well as the broader issues of economic strategy, political economy, and culture. Collectively, the articles in this book provide readers with a sense of where Singapore has gone and where it is in terms of tourism management and policy.

Book excerpt: Ranked among the top three destinations in Asia by the WEF's 2017 Tourism Competitiveness Report, Singapore is one of the most attractive destinations in the region due to its state-of-the-art infrastructure, low crime rates, cultural diversity and the abundance of luxury market options. As tourism receipts hit a record high in 2017, Singapore's tourism industry is looking to expand its dominance even further by leveraging the latest technology and trends to reach new and capture more of the existing markets."

Considered one of the world, s top medical travel destinations, Singapore attracts more than 410,000 international patients to its hospitals and treatment centers and expects that number to grow to one million by 2012. The country boasts 13 JCI-accredited healthcare facilities, and its healthcare system was ranked the best in Asia and sixth best in the world by the World Health Organization (the US was ranked 36th). Singapore's 35 international clinics and hospitals offer nearly every imaginable medical procedure - at a 30 to 60 percent saving over U.S. prices.
